# 1inch Java SDK

A comprehensive Java SDK for the 1inch DEX Aggregation Protocol, providing easy integration with 1inch's swap, token, token-details, orderbook, and history services.

## Features

- ✅ Java 11 compatible
- ✅ Modern reactive programming with RxJava 3
- ✅ Interface-driven design for easy testing and mocking
- ✅ Multiple programming approaches: reactive, synchronous, and asynchronous
- ✅ OkHttp with HTTP/2 support and connection pooling
- ✅ Type-safe REST API integration with Retrofit 2
- ✅ Comprehensive error handling
- ✅ Built-in logging with SLF4J
- ✅ Full Swap API support with chainId path parameters
- ✅ Complete Token API with multi-chain support
- ✅ Token Details API with pricing and chart data
- ✅ Orderbook API for limit order management
- ✅ History API for transaction history tracking
- ✅ Portfolio API for DeFi position tracking and analytics
- ✅ Balance API for token balance and allowance checking
- ✅ Price API for real-time token pricing across 60+ currencies
- ✅ Fusion API for gasless swaps with professional market makers
- ✅ FusionPlus API for cross-chain gasless swaps with enhanced security
- ✅ Type-safe models with Jackson and BigInteger precision
- ✅ Extensive unit test coverage

## High-Precision Arithmetic

The SDK uses `BigInteger` for all amount-related fields to ensure precision when handling cryptocurrency values, which can exceed the range of standard numeric types:

- **Amount fields**: `QuoteRequest.amount`, `SwapRequest.amount`
- **Response amounts**: `QuoteResponse.dstAmount`, `SwapResponse.dstAmount`
- **Gas-related fields**: `gasPrice`, `gasLimit`, `gas`
- **Transaction values**: `TransactionData.value`, `TransactionData.gasPrice`
- **Token allowances**: `AllowanceResponse.allowance`

```java
import java.math.BigInteger;

// Wei amounts (18 decimals for ETH)
BigInteger oneEth = new BigInteger("1000000000000000000");
BigInteger halfEth = new BigInteger("500000000000000000");

// Gas price in wei (20 gwei)
BigInteger gasPrice = new BigInteger("20000000000");

QuoteRequest request = QuoteRequest.builder()
.amount(oneEth)
.gasPrice(gasPrice)
.build();
```

**Why BigInteger?**
- Ethereum amounts are measured in wei (10^18 units per ETH)
- Values can exceed `Long.MAX_VALUE` (9,223,372,036,854,775,807)
- BigInteger prevents overflow and precision loss
- Native JSON serialization support via Jackson

## Programming Approaches

The SDK supports three programming approaches to fit different use cases:

### 🔄 Reactive (RxJava)
- **Best for**: Complex async workflows, chaining operations, backpressure handling
- **Returns**: `Single` for reactive composition
- **Example**: `client.swap().getQuoteRx(request)`

### ⚡ Synchronous
- **Best for**: Simple scripts, blocking workflows, traditional programming
- **Returns**: Direct response objects
- **Example**: `client.swap().getQuote(request)`

### 🚀 Asynchronous (CompletableFuture)
- **Best for**: Java 8+ async patterns, parallel execution
- **Returns**: `CompletableFuture` for async composition
- **Example**: `client.swap().getQuoteAsync(request)`

## API Coverage

### Swap API (`client.swap()`) - **Chain-Specific**
All Swap API operations require a specific chainId and operate on that blockchain:
- ✅ `getQuote(chainId, ...)` - Find the best quote to swap on specific chain
- ✅ `getSwap(chainId, ...)` - Generate calldata for swap execution on specific chain
- ✅ `getSpender(chainId)` - Get 1inch Router address for specific chain
- ✅ `getApproveTransaction(chainId, ...)` - Generate token approval calldata for specific chain
- ✅ `getAllowance(chainId, ...)` - Check token allowance on specific chain

### Token API (`client.token()`) - **Multi-Chain + Chain-Specific**
Supports both multi-chain operations and chain-specific queries:

**Multi-Chain Operations:**
- ✅ `getMultiChainTokens()` - Get whitelisted tokens across all chains
- ✅ `getMultiChainTokenList()` - Get token list across all chains
- ✅ `searchMultiChainTokens()` - Search tokens across multiple chains

**Chain-Specific Operations:**
- ✅ `getTokens(chainId, ...)` - Get whitelisted tokens for specific chain
- ✅ `getTokenList(chainId, ...)` - Get chain-specific token list in standard format
- ✅ `searchTokens(chainId, ...)` - Search tokens on specific chain
- ✅ `getCustomTokens(chainId, ...)` - Get token info for multiple custom addresses on specific chain
- ✅ `getCustomToken(chainId, address)` - Get token info for single custom address on specific chain

### Token Details API (`client.tokenDetails()`) - **Chain-Specific**
All Token Details operations require a specific chainId:
- ✅ `getTokenDetails(chainId, address, ...)` - Get token details with pricing data for specific chain
- ✅ `getTokenChart(chainId, address, ...)` - Get token price chart data for specific chain
- ✅ `getTokenPriceChange(chainId, address, ...)` - Get token price changes over time for specific chain
- ✅ `getNativeTokenDetails(chainId, ...)` - Get native token details with pricing for specific chain
- ✅ `getNativeTokenChart(chainId, ...)` - Get native token chart data for specific chain
- ✅ `getNativeTokenChartByRange(chainId, ...)` - Get native token chart for date range on specific chain
- ✅ `getNativeTokenChartByInterval(chainId, ...)` - Get native token chart by interval for specific chain
- ✅ `getNativeTokenPriceChange(chainId, ...)` - Get native token price changes for specific chain
- ✅ `getMultiChainTokenPriceChange(tokens)` - Get multi-chain token price changes (accepts list of chain/token pairs)

### Orderbook API (`client.orderbook()`) - **Chain-Specific**
All Orderbook operations require a specific chainId:
- ✅ `createLimitOrder(chainId, ...)` - Create a new limit order on specific chain
- ✅ `getLimitOrdersByAddress(chainId, address, ...)` - Get orders for specific address on specific chain
- ✅ `getOrderByOrderHash(chainId, orderHash)` - Get order by hash on specific chain
- ✅ `getAllLimitOrders(chainId, ...)` - Get all limit orders with filters on specific chain
- ✅ `getOrdersCount(chainId, ...)` - Get count of orders by filters on specific chain
- ✅ `getEventsByOrderHash(chainId, orderHash, ...)` - Get events for specific order on specific chain
- ✅ `getAllEvents(chainId, ...)` - Get all order events on specific chain
- ✅ `hasActiveOrdersWithPermit(chainId, ...)` - Check active orders with permit on specific chain
- ✅ `getUniqueActivePairs(chainId, ...)` - Get unique active trading pairs on specific chain

### History API (`client.history()`) - **Multi-Chain**
History operations can work across chains with optional chainId filtering:
- ✅ `getHistoryEvents(address, chainId?, ...)` - Get transaction history for an address with optional chain filtering

### Portfolio API (`client.portfolio()`) - **Multi-Chain**
Portfolio operations provide comprehensive DeFi position tracking and analytics:
- ✅ `getServiceStatus()` - Check Portfolio API service availability
- ✅ `getSupportedChains()` - Get list of supported blockchain networks
- ✅ `getSupportedProtocols()` - Get list of supported DeFi protocols
- ✅ `checkAddresses(addresses)` - Validate wallet addresses for portfolio tracking
- ✅ `getCurrentValue(request)` - Get current portfolio value breakdown by address, category, and chain
- ✅ `getProtocolsSnapshot(request)` - Get detailed protocol positions and underlying tokens
- ✅ `getTokensSnapshot(request)` - Get token positions across all DeFi protocols
- ✅ `getProtocolsMetrics(request)` - Get profit/loss, ROI, and APR metrics for protocol positions
- ✅ `getTokensMetrics(request)` - Get profit/loss, ROI, and APR metrics for token positions

### Price API (`client.price()`) - **Chain-Specific**
Real-time token pricing across multiple currencies and chains:
- ✅ `getWhitelistPrices(chainId, currency)` - Get prices for all whitelisted tokens on specific chain
- ✅ `getPrices(request)` - Get prices for specific token addresses with currency conversion
- ✅ `getPrice(chainId, address, currency)` - Get price for single token with currency conversion
- ✅ `getSupportedCurrencies(chainId)` - Get list of supported fiat currencies for price conversion

**Currency Support**: 60+ fiat currencies (USD, EUR, JPY, GBP, CNY, etc.) + native Wei format
**Multi-Chain**: 13+ blockchain networks supported

### Fusion API (`client.fusionOrders()`, `client.fusionQuoter()`, `client.fusionRelayer()`) - **Chain-Specific**
1inch's revolutionary gasless swap technology with professional market makers:
- ✅ `getQuote(request)` - Get quotes with auction presets (fast/medium/slow/custom)
- ✅ `getQuoteWithCustomPresets(request, preset)` - Get quotes with custom auction parameters
- ✅ `getActiveOrders(request)` - Get currently active orders in the Fusion network
- ✅ `getSettlementContract(chainId)` - Get settlement contract address for chain
- ✅ `getOrderByOrderHash(chainId, hash)` - Get order status and fills by hash
- ✅ `getOrdersByOrderHashes(chainId, request)` - Get multiple orders by hashes
- ✅ `getOrdersByMaker(request)` - Get order history for specific maker address
- ✅ `submitOrder(chainId, signedOrder)` - Submit single order to Fusion network
- ✅ `submitManyOrders(chainId, signedOrders)` - Submit multiple orders in batch

### FusionPlus API (`client.fusionPlusOrders()`, `client.fusionPlusQuoter()`, `client.fusionPlusRelayer()`) - **Cross-Chain**
1inch's next-generation cross-chain gasless swap technology with enhanced security:
- ✅ `getQuote(request)` - Get cross-chain quotes with escrow and time lock configurations
- ✅ `getQuoteWithCustomPresets(request, preset)` - Get cross-chain quotes with custom auction parameters
- ✅ `buildQuoteTypedData(request, body)` - Build cross-chain orders with EIP712 typed data and secret hashes
- ✅ `getActiveOrders(request)` - Get currently active cross-chain orders in the FusionPlus network
- ✅ `getOrderByOrderHash(srcChain, dstChain, hash)` - Get cross-chain order status by hash
- ✅ `getOrdersByOrderHashes(srcChain, dstChain, hashes)` - Get multiple cross-chain orders by hashes
- ✅ `getOrdersByMaker(srcChain, dstChain, address, page, limit)` - Get cross-chain order history for maker
- ✅ `getEscrowEvents(srcChain, dstChain, orderHash, page, limit)` - Get escrow events for cross-chain orders
- ✅ `getPublicActions(srcChain, dstChain, orderHash)` - Get available public actions for cross-chain orders
- ✅ `getSupportedChains()` - Get list of supported chains for FusionPlus
- ✅ `submitOrder(srcChainId, signedOrder)` - Submit single cross-chain order to FusionPlus network
- ✅ `submitManyOrders(srcChainId, signedOrders)` - Submit multiple cross-chain orders in batch
- ✅ `submitSecret(chainId, secretInput)` - Submit secret for cross-chain order execution (atomic swap completion)

### Balance API (`client.balance()`) - **Chain-Specific**
Balance operations provide token balance and allowance checking across different chains:
- ✅ `getBalances(request)` - Get all token balances for a wallet address on specific chain
- ✅ `getCustomBalances(request)` - Get balances for specific tokens on specific chain
- ✅ `getAllowances(request)` - Get token allowances by spender for wallet on specific chain
- ✅ `getCustomAllowances(request)` - Get allowances for specific tokens by spender on specific chain
- ✅ `getAllowancesAndBalances(request)` - Get combined balance and allowance data on specific chain
- ✅ `getCustomAllowancesAndBalances(request)` - Get combined data for specific tokens on specific chain
- ✅ `getAggregatedBalancesAndAllowances(request)` - Get aggregated data for multiple wallets on specific chain
- ✅ `getBalancesByMultipleWallets(request)` - Get balances for multiple wallets and tokens on specific chain

## Configuration

### Authentication
You need a valid API key from 1inch. Get one at [1inch Developer Portal](https://portal.1inch.dev/).

#### Using Explicit API Key
```java
OneInchClient client = OneInchClient.builder()
.apiKey("your-api-key")
.build();
```

#### Using Environment Variable
Set the `ONEINCH_API_KEY` environment variable:
```bash
export ONEINCH_API_KEY="your-api-key-here"
```

Then create the client without explicitly providing the API key:
```java
// Reads API key from ONEINCH_API_KEY environment variable
OneInchClient client = OneInchClient.builder().build();

// Or use the parameterless constructor
OneInchClient client = new OneInchClient();
```

**Priority**: Explicit API key takes precedence over environment variable.

### Custom OkHttp Client
```java
OkHttpClient customOkHttpClient = new OkHttpClient.Builder()
.connectTimeout(30, TimeUnit.SECONDS)
.readTimeout(30, TimeUnit.SECONDS)
.build();

OneInchClient client = OneInchClient.builder()
.apiKey("your-api-key")
.okHttpClient(customOkHttpClient)
.build();
```

### Reactive Swap Flow
```java
import io.reactivex.rxjava3.schedulers.Schedulers;
import java.math.BigInteger;

try (OneInchClient client = OneInchClient.builder()
.build()) { // Uses ONEINCH_API_KEY environment variable

BigInteger swapAmount = new BigInteger("10000000000000000"); // 0.01 ETH in wei
String walletAddress = "0x742f4d5b7dbf2e4f0ddeadd3d1b4b8b4c1b8b8b8";

// Reactive chaining with proper error handling
client.swap().getSpenderRx(1) // Ethereum
.doOnSuccess(spender -> log.info("Spender: {}", spender.getAddress()))
.flatMap(spender -> {
// Check allowance
AllowanceRequest allowanceRequest = AllowanceRequest.builder()
.chainId(1) // Ethereum
.tokenAddress("0x111111111117dc0aa78b770fa6a738034120c302")
.walletAddress(walletAddress)
.build();
return client.swap().getAllowanceRx(allowanceRequest);
})
.flatMap(allowance -> {
// Get quote
QuoteRequest quoteRequest = QuoteRequest.builder()
.chainId(1) // Ethereum
.src("0xe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eee") // ETH
.dst("0x111111111117dc0aa78b770fa6a738034120c302") // 1INCH
.amount(swapAmount)
.includeTokensInfo(true)
.includeGas(true)
.build();
return client.swap().getQuoteRx(quoteRequest);
})
.flatMap(quote -> {
// Get swap transaction data
SwapRequest swapRequest = SwapRequest.builder()
.chainId(1) // Ethereum
.src("0xe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eee")
.dst("0x111111111117dc0aa78b770fa6a738034120c302")
.amount(swapAmount)
.from(walletAddress)
.origin(walletAddress)
.slippage(1.0)
.build();
return client.swap().getSwapRx(swapRequest);
})
.subscribe(
swap -> {
log.info("Swap ready!");
log.info("To: {}", swap.getTx().getTo());
log.info("Value: {}", swap.getTx().getValue());
log.info("Expected output: {}", swap.getDstAmount());
},
error -> log.error("Swap flow failed", error)
);
}
```

## Error Handling

The SDK provides structured error handling for all programming approaches:

### Synchronous Error Handling
```java
try {
QuoteResponse quote = client.swap().getQuote(quoteRequest);
} catch (OneInchApiException e) {
log.error("API Error: {} (Status: {}, Request ID: {})",
e.getDescription(), e.getStatusCode(), e.getRequestId());
} catch (OneInchException e) {
log.error("SDK Error: {}", e.getMessage());
}
```

### Reactive Error Handling
```java
client.swap().getQuoteRx(quoteRequest)
.doOnError(error -> {
if (error instanceof OneInchApiException) {
OneInchApiException apiError = (OneInchApiException) error;
log.error("API Error: {}", apiError.getDescription());
} else if (error instanceof OneInchException) {
log.error("SDK Error: {}", error.getMessage());
}
})
.subscribe(
quote -> log.info("Success: {}", quote.getDstAmount()),
error -> log.error("Failed", error)
);
```

## Testing

### Unit Tests
Run the mock unit tests (no API key required):
```bash
# Test all modules
mvn test

# Test only core SDK
mvn test -pl oneinch-sdk-core
```

### Integration Tests
To run integration tests with real API calls:

1. **Set up API key configuration**:
```bash
# Copy the sample configuration
cp test.properties.sample test.properties

# Edit test.properties and add your real API key
nano test.properties
```

2. **Add your API key to test.properties**:
```properties
ONEINCH_API_KEY=your-actual-api-key-here
```

3. **Run integration tests**:
```bash
# Run only integration tests
mvn test -pl oneinch-sdk-core -Dtest=OneInchIntegrationTest

# Or run all tests (unit + integration)
mvn test
```

**Note**: `test.properties` is gitignored to prevent accidental commits of API keys. Always use `test.properties.sample` as a reference for the expected format.
